2010 ITM Cup review - Week One

NZPA and James Mortimer - (1/08/2010)

Allblacks.com and itmcup.co.nz bring you all the results, standings, leading points and try scorers and next weeks games after week one of the 2010 ITM Cup.

Pass It On

Results and standings after the opening round of national provincial rugby championship:-

THURSDAY

At New Plymouth: Northland 26 (Dean Budd, Simon Munro, Lachie Munro tries; Lachie Munro 3 pen, con) Taranaki 19 (Chris Walker try; Willie Ripia 4 pen, con). Halftime: 18-19.

FRIDAY

At Christchurch: Canterbury 23 (Sean Maitland, Tu Umaga-Marshall tries; Colin Slade 3 pen, 2 con) Hawke's Bay 23 (Hika Elliot try; Daniel Kirkpatrick 3 pen, Andrew Horrell 3 pen). Halftime: 13-17.

SATURDAY

At Palmerston North: Southland 37 (Mark Wells, Elliott Dixon, Jamie Mackintosh, Scott Cowan, James Wilson tries; Robbie Robinson 3 con, Wilson 2 pen) Manawatu 23 (Aaron Smith, Hadleigh Parkes tries; Craig Clare 3 pen, Shannon Paku 2 con). Halftime: 19-9.

At Pukekohe: Counties-Manukau 29 (Ahsee Tuala 2, Siale Piutau, Tim Nanai-Williams tries; Dean Cummins pen, 3 con) Otago 13 (Chris Small try; Glenn Dickson 2 pen, con). Halftime: 22-6.

At Hamilton: Waikato 13 (Brendon Leonard try; Trent Renata pen, con) Bay of Plenty 10 (Tanirau Latimier try; Daniel Waenga pen, Phil Burleigh con). Halftime: 10-3.

SUNDAY

At Albany: Auckland 36 (Chay Raui, Daniel Braid, Brent Ward, Dave Thomas tries; Ash Moeke 2 pen, con, Matt Berquist 2 pen, con) North Harbour 14 (Tom Chamberlain try; Luke McAlister 3 pen). Halftime: 15-14.

At Wellington: Wellington 20 (Dane Coles, Jeremy Thrush, Julian Savea tries; Fa'atonu Fili pen, con) Tasman 11 (Robbie Malneek try; Steve Alfeld 2 pen). Halftime: 15-8.

Standings
(played, won, drawn, lost, for, against, bonus points, total points)

Auckland 1 1 0 0 36 14 1 5
Counties-Manukau 1 1 0 0 29 13 1 5
Southland 1 1 0 0 37 23 1 5
Wellington 1 1 0 0 20 11 0 4
Northland 1 1 0 0 26 19 0 4
Waikato 1 1 0 0 13 10 0 4
Hawke's Bay 1 0 1 0 23 23 0 2
Canterbury 1 0 1 0 23 23 0 2
Bay of Plenty 1 0 0 1 10 13 1 1
Taranaki 1 0 0 1 19 26 1 1
Tasman 1 0 0 1 11 20 0 0
Manawatu 1 0 0 1 23 37 0 0
Otago 1 0 0 1 13 29 0 0
North Harbour 1 0 0 1 14 36 0 0
